CHANGE IS THE LAW OF LIFE

   Posted by: pastordiehl   in Change and You

One more blog on change. Henry Kissinger is a sought after expert on world affairs. Few people understand what happens around the world politically more than him. He said this of change: “For any student of history, change is the law of life. Any attempt to contain it guarantees an explosion down the road; the more rigid the adherence to the status quo, the more violent the ultimate outcome will be.”

On a lighter note, Ken Gaub says it like this: “If you continue to think like you always thought, you’ll always get what you always got!”

Ready or not, your life will change!
